Pooling is the combining of all oil and gas interests in a drilling unit. In most cases, the owners of oil and gas rights in a unit sign a lease with a developer that allows for pooling. If there is more than one developer in a unit, they voluntarily agree on a development plan.
Declaration of a Pooled Unit Such a document delineates what portions of the leases are included in a unit. It also places third parties on notice. ing to the terms of the leases, any production from the wells in the pooled unit must maintain underlying leases or portions if this is applicable.

Partial Assignments: When an assignor conveys 100% record title interest in a portion of the lands in a lease, it creates a partial assignment. Partial assignments segregate the lease into two separate leases. Normally we assign a new lease number to the conveyed portion of the lease.

In a few words, a pooling clause is written into a lease. This oil and gas clause allows the leased premises to be combined with other lands to form a single drilling unit. It's not uncommon for there to be a pool of oil or gas under numerous parcels of land.
What is the granting clause? The granting clause is the clause under which the owner of the oil and gas rights leases the oil and gas rights to the oil and gas company along with the right to develop the oil and gas on a specifically described piece of real estate.
